More than €50,000 embezzled from football supporter club

More than 50 thousand euros was embezzled from football club Willem II's official supporter club by the former treasurer. This is according to research done by Brabants Dagblad. According to the newspaper, the supporter club's former treasurer, who recently passed away at the age of 67, embezzled the money away over several years, using a number of measures including forged bank statements. The supporter club's board has pressed charges and the family of the deceased treasurer has been informed. Supporter club chairman Jan van den Dries confirmed the embezzlement to the newspaper. "I will give a full explanation at the general members meeting on Monday. But I do want to stress that the money collected through various actions for a statue of Jan van Roessel, is still their. It is in a different account." Willem II CEO Berry van Gool stressed that the supporter club is separate from the football club. "But we are suffering with them a bit. This if very annoying for them financially as well as a personal tragedy."
